免费试用

中文化、本土化、云端化的在线跨平台软件开发工具,支持APP、电脑端、小程序、IOS免签等等

app支付开发绑定个人

App支付是移动应用程序中常用的支付方式之一,它允许用户使用手机或平板电脑进行线上购物、支付服务费用等。在进行App支付时,绑定个人账户是一个常见的流程,本文将为您介绍App支付开发中绑定个人的原理和详细流程。

一、绑定个人的原理

App支付的绑定个人功能是通过将用户的支付宝或微信账号与App应用进行绑定,实现在App内直接进行支付的功能。其原理如下:

1. 用户在App内选择进行支付,并选择使用支付宝或微信支付;

2. 用户通过App将支付请求发送到服务器;

3. 服务器将支付请求转发给支付宝或微信支付平台;

4. 用户通过支付宝或微信支付平台完成支付,同时获取支付结果;

5. 支付宝或微信支付平台将支付结果返回给服务器;

6. 服务器将支付结果返回给App,并在App内展示支付结果。

二、绑定个人的详细流程

下面将为您详细介绍App支付开发中绑定个人的流程:

1. 在App界面中添加“绑定个人”的入口,一般以按钮或链接的形式呈现;

2. 当用户点击“绑定个人”入口时,App会跳转到支付宝或微信支付的授权页面;

3. 用户在授权页面中输入支付宝或微信账号和密码,并点击确认按钮;

4. 支付宝或微信支付平台验证账号和密码的正确性,并向App返回授权结果;

5. App将授权结果发送给服务器进行处理;

6. 服务器将授权结果保存,并向App发送绑定成功或失败的消息;

7. App根据服务器返回的结果,展示绑定成功或失败的提示信息给用户。

值得注意的是,支付宝和微信支付平台都提供了相关的SDK和API,供开发者在App中集成支付功能。开发者可以根据支付宝或微信支付平台提供的文档,调用相应的接口实现绑定个人和支付功能。

三、开发注意事项

在进行App支付开发中,有几点需要注意:

1. 安全性:为了保护用户的个人信息和支付安全,开发者应使用支付宝和微信支付平台提供的安全机制,如密钥签名、HTTPS等,确保交互过程中的数据传输安全;

2. 用户体验:在绑定个人的过程中,应尽量简化操作步骤,减少用户的等待时间和输入量,提升用户体验;

3. 错误处理:在绑定个人和支付过程中,应考虑各种可能发生的错误情况,并给予用户相应的提示,以提高用户交互的友好性;

4. 法律合规:在进行App支付开发时,应确保遵守相关的法律法规,如用户协议、隐私政策等,保护用户权益。

综上所述,App支付开发中绑定个人的原理是将用户的支付宝或微信账号与App进行绑定,实现在App内直接进行支付的功能。开发者需要在App中添加绑定个人入口,并通过支付宝和微信支付平台的SDK和API实现绑定个人和支付功能。在开发过程中,需要注重安全性、用户体验、错误处理和法律合规等方面的考虑。希望本文对您有所帮助!


相关知识:
如何开发一个手机通讯app
开发一个手机通讯app可以让用户更方便地与朋友、家人和同事保持联系。这篇文章将介绍开发一个手机通讯app的基本原理和步骤。1. 确定功能在开发一个手机通讯app之前,你需要确定它的主要功能。这可能包括实时聊天、语音通话、视频通话、发送短信、发送图片或视频等
2024-01-10
千米红包扫雷系统源生app开发
千米红包扫雷系统是一种红包互动游戏,可以让玩家在游戏中获得红包奖励,同时也可以增加社交互动的乐趣。在这篇文章中,我将详细介绍千米红包扫雷系统的原理和开发流程。一、千米红包扫雷系统的原理千米红包扫雷系统是一种基于互联网的游戏,可以通过网络连接来实现玩家之间的
2024-01-10
app开发需要什么编程语言
APP(Application)是指能够在移动设备上运行的应用程序。而移动设备包括智能手机、平板电脑等。在开发APP时,我们需要选择适合的编程语言来实现所需的功能。以下是几种常用的APP开发编程语言及其原理和详细介绍。1. JavaJava是一种面向对象的
2023-06-29
app开发报价单吧
标题:App开发报价单概述与详细介绍随着智能手机的快速普及,移动App已经成为人们日常生活中不可或缺的一部分。越来越多的企业、机构或个人选择开发自己的App来满足用户需求、建立品牌形象以及提升业务。然而,许多有意向开发App的朋友们在面对App开发报价单时
2023-06-29
app开发具体设计的技术指标
在进行APP开发具体设计时,有很多技术指标需要考虑,以下是其中一些主要的技术指标。1. 响应速度:响应速度是指用户按下按钮或其他操作后,App能够多快地做出反应,以及App加载和卸载的速度。响应速度对用户体验非常重要,如果响应速度过慢,用户很可能会因为等待
2023-06-29
app后台管理开发教程
随着手机应用市场的蓬勃发展,越来越多的企业开始投入到移动应用商务中。而为了更好地管理这些应用程序,企业需要一套完整的后台管理系统,用于统一处理用户、订单、反馈等数据。本文将详细介绍如何开发一个移动应用后台管理系统。一、技术架构采用前后端分离架构,后端提供接
2023-05-06